About Behavioral Healthcare/Fauquier
Behavioral Healthcare/Fauquier provides outpatient addiction treatment and mental health services for adults in Warrenton and Fauquier County, Virginia. Operating since 1969, this recovery center offers substance abuse treatment through flexible, affordable programs with financial assistance options.
Behavioral Healthcare/Fauquier serves as an established outpatient treatment provider for adults seeking substance abuse treatment and mental health care in Warrenton, Virginia. Located on Franklin Road SW in Fauquier County, this recovery center has supported the local community since 1969, building decades of experience in addressing both substance use disorders and co-occurring mental health conditions. The facility operates as part of the broader BRBH network, focusing specifically on outpatient services for adult populations across Fauquier County and surrounding areas.
The center's outpatient program addresses substance use disorders alongside mental health conditions, recognizing the interconnected nature of these challenges in the recovery process. This dual-diagnosis approach allows clients to work on both addiction recovery and mental health stability within the same treatment setting. The outpatient structure enables individuals to maintain work, family, and community connections while participating in regular treatment sessions, making it particularly valuable for those transitioning from residential treatment or seeking ongoing recovery support.

Frequently Asked Questions
What types of addiction treatment does Behavioral Healthcare/Fauquier provide?
The center offers outpatient treatment programs for adults with substance use disorders. They also treat co-occurring mental health conditions alongside addiction, providing integrated care for both issues simultaneously.
What insurance does the recovery center accept?
Behavioral Healthcare/Fauquier accepts Medicaid and Medicare for treatment services. They also offer financial assistance applications for individuals who need help covering treatment costs beyond insurance coverage.
What are the operating hours for outpatient treatment?
The facility operates Monday through Friday, with standard hours 8:30 AM to 4:30 PM most days. Extended evening hours until 8:30 PM are available Tuesday through Thursday to accommodate working adults and those with daytime commitments.
Who can receive treatment at this recovery center?
The center serves adults with substance use disorders and mental health conditions. Services are provided in English and focus specifically on the adult population throughout Fauquier County and the Warrenton area.
How long has Behavioral Healthcare/Fauquier been serving the recovery community?
The center has been providing addiction treatment and mental health services since 1969, giving them over 50 years of experience serving the Fauquier County community. This long-standing presence demonstrates their commitment to local recovery support.
Where is the recovery center located?
Behavioral Healthcare/Fauquier is located at 1315 Franklin Road SW in Warrenton, Virginia. The facility serves residents throughout Fauquier County, providing convenient local access to outpatient addiction treatment.
Can I continue working while attending outpatient treatment?
Yes, the outpatient program structure is designed to allow participants to maintain employment and family responsibilities. Evening hours Tuesday through Thursday specifically accommodate working adults who need addiction treatment that fits around their schedule.
Does the center treat both addiction and mental health together?
The facility specializes in treating both substance use disorders and mental health conditions simultaneously. This integrated approach addresses co-occurring disorders in one location, eliminating the need to coordinate care between separate providers.
